Registrations are invited for Junior Space Scientist Program 2024 for Students in Classes 8-12 by Agastya International Foundation. The program duration is from May 3 to June 1, 2024.
Agastya International Foundation is an Indian education trust and non-profit organization based in Bangalore, India whose mission is “to spark curiosity, nurture creativity and instill confidence” among economically disadvantaged children and teachers in India.
Unleash your passion for space and science with the Junior Space Scientist Program! This virtual research program offers high school students a unique opportunity to work on space-related projects and receive mentorship from professionals in the field.
Open to students in grades 8 to 12, this 5-week virtual program provides students with a problem statement to work on, resources, and hands-on training on conducting research, taking notes, writing reports, and presenting their findings.
